Pavy, Frederick (medicine)


Pavy, Frederick
<person> English physician, 1829-1911.

holograph(1) (iou)



holograph noun & adjective. E17.
[French holographe or late Latin holographus from Greek holographos: see HOLO-, -GRAPH.]
A. noun. A document etc. wholly written by hand by the person named as its author. E17.
b. adjective. (Of a document etc.) wholly written by the hand of the person named as the author; spec. in Scot. & US Law, (of a will) written by the hand of and signed by the testator and thereby valid. E18.
